Coach Taylor: More Than Just a Whistle

Of course, we can't talk about Friday Night Lights without mentioning the legendary Coach Eric Taylor, played by the incredible Kyle Chandler. In this episode, he's juggling the pressure of the championship game with his unwavering commitment to his players.

Beyond the X's and O's, it's Coach Taylor's ability to connect with these young men that makes him so compelling. He's a father figure, a mentor, and a constant source of tough love.

Tim Riggins: Forever a Heartthrob

Taylor Kitsch as Tim Riggins stole hearts episode after episode. In "Black Eyes and Broken Hearts," Tim grapples with loyalty and the consequences of his actions.

Riggins is that guy you know you shouldn't root for, but you just can't help it! His rough exterior hides a surprisingly vulnerable soul. The eternal question: Riggins, what are you doing now?

Lyla Garrity: From Cheerleader to Something More

Minka Kelly’s Lyla Garrity evolved so much throughout the first season. This episode finds her at a crossroads, dealing with relationships and her own ambitions.

She proves she is more than just a cheerleader, battling through personal dramas with grace and intelligence. Lyla's journey in the show reminded us that high school is a time of massive self-discovery.

Matt Saracen: The Reluctant Quarterback

Zach Gilford as Matt Saracen, the backup quarterback thrust into the spotlight, was a fan favorite. In the finale, the pressure is on him to lead the Panthers to victory.

Saracen is the ultimate underdog, showcasing quiet strength and unwavering determination. He embodies the spirit of Dillon, reminding us that heroes can come in unexpected packages.

Julie Taylor: Daughter of Dillon

Aimee Teegarden played Julie Taylor, Coach Taylor's daughter, offering a relatable perspective on life in Dillon. She's navigating teenage angst and complicated relationships in this episode.

Julie gives us a glimpse into the challenges of growing up in a football-obsessed town. Her complex dynamic with her father resonates with many.

Landry Clarke: The Unsung Hero

Jesse Plemons as Landry Clarke, Matt Saracen's best friend, provided much-needed comic relief and unwavering support. He's the loyal friend we all wish we had.

Landry might not be a star athlete, but his loyalty to Matt is unwavering. He often delivers some of the show's most memorable lines, a true testament to his underrated talent.

Smash Williams: The Star Running Back

Gaius Charles portrayed Smash Williams, the talented running back with dreams of college stardom. In this episode, Smash is determined to prove himself.

His drive and ambition are contagious, but he also faces challenges both on and off the field. He highlights the pressures placed upon young athletes, especially those from disadvantaged backgrounds.
